Form 4: SSR Mining Director Thomas Bates Jr. Increases Equity Holdings with DSU Grant

Sentiment:

Insider Transaction Report


SSR Mining Inc. Director Thomas R. Bates Jr. reported the acquisition of 926 Deferred Share Units, increasing his beneficial ownership to 120,507 DSUs.

Summary

  • Thomas R. Bates Jr., a Director of SSR Mining Inc., acquired 926 Deferred Share Units (DSUs).
  • The transaction date for this acquisition was July 1, 2025.
  • Following this transaction, Mr. Bates beneficially owns a total of 120,507 DSUs.
  • Each DSU represents the right to receive the cash value of one Common Share of SSR Mining Inc.
  • DSUs are earned upon grant and are settled when the reporting person retires from the Issuer's Board of Directors.
